Filing an action

Compensation for mesothelioma may assist patients with funeral expenses, medical expenses and lost income. It can also allow families to live in peace while a loved one is suffering and dying. The mesothelioma lawyers who have a wealth of experience in asbestos litigation will handle the legal process so clients and their families don't need to worry about it.

A qualified lawyer will gather the appropriate evidence to support the case and make a lawsuit. It can take several months. However, mesothelioma lawyers typically know how to expedite the legal process so that victims receive compensation faster rather than later.

Mesothelioma cases can be filed as personal injury claims or wrongful death lawsuits. There could be multiple defendants involved, since asbestos companies are well-known for providing various asbestos-related products in different states. Lawyers for mesothelioma can look through the corporate documents of asbestos-related companies to determine the date and time when asbestos exposure occurred. They will then determine the best state to file the claim in.

A lawsuit can be settled outside of court or tried in court. Most mesothelioma cases can be resolved without a court. This is due to the fact that most of the time asbestos companies are unable defend themselves against a mesothelioma lawsuit and they will agree to compensate victims in order to avoid the long-winded trial.

If a lawsuit is brought to trial the jury will decide on how much each victim is awarded. Damages are typically classified into two categories, economic and noneconomic. Economic damages are based on treatment costs such as lost wages, medical expenses and other expenses that are documented in connection with the diagnosis. Noneconomic damages are based on the plaintiff's pain and suffering, and can be awarded in conjunction with economic damages.
